Wendell

Gender: M Popularity: this week. Origin of Wendell: German Meaning of Wendell: "to travel, to proceed"

This name has hardly been used since Wendell Willkie ran for president in 1940, and doesn't feel anywhere near ready for a revival.

Famous People Named Wendell

Wendell Alexis, American basketball player
Wendell Anderson, American politician from Minnesota
Wendell Berry, American novelist and poet
Wendell Bryant, American football player
Wendell Burton, American actor and singer
Wendell H. Ford, American politician from Kentucky
Wendell Johnson, American psychologist and author
Wendell Lawrence, Bahamian triple jumper
Wendell H. Murphy, American politician from North Carolina
Wendell Phillips, American abolitionist and activist
Wendell Sailor, Australian rugby player
Wendell Meredith Stanley, American biochemist
Wendell Willkie, American politician
